Summary:
Our events all follow a common pattern, so there's no good reason why the configuration should be so verbose. This diff eliminates that redundancy, and gives us the freedom to simplify the underlying mechanism in future without further churning the call sites.

#import "RCTEventDispatcher.h"
#import "RCTAssert.h"
#import "RCTBridge.h"
#import "RCTUtils.h"
const NSInteger RCTTextUpdateLagWarningThreshold = 3;
NSString *RCTNormalizeInputEventName(NSString *eventName)
{
if ([eventName hasPrefix:@"on"]) {
eventName = [eventName stringByReplacingCharactersInRange:(NSRange){0, 2} withString:@"top"];
} else if (![eventName hasPrefix:@"top"]) {
eventName = [[@"top" stringByAppendingString:[eventName substringToIndex:1].uppercaseString]
stringByAppendingString:[eventName substringFromIndex:1]];
}
return eventName;
}
static NSNumber *RCTGetEventID(id<RCTEvent> event)
{
return @(
[event.viewTag intValue] |
(((uint64_t)event.eventName.hash & 0xFFFF) << 32) |
(((uint64_t)event.coalescingKey) << 48)
);
}
@implementation RCTBaseEvent
@synthesize viewTag = _viewTag;
@synthesize eventName = _eventName;
@synthesize body = _body;
- (instancetype)initWithViewTag:(NSNumber *)viewTag
eventName:(NSString *)eventName
body:(NSDictionary *)body
{
if (RCT_DEBUG) {
RCTAssertParam(eventName);
}
if ((self = [super init])) {
_viewTag = viewTag;
_eventName = eventName;
_body = body;
}
return self;
}
RCT_NOT_IMPLEMENTED(-init)
- (uint16_t)coalescingKey
{
return 0;
}
- (BOOL)canCoalesce
{
return YES;
}
- (id<RCTEvent>)coalesceWithEvent:(id<RCTEvent>)newEvent
{
return newEvent;
}
+ (NSString *)moduleDotMethod
{
return nil;
}
@end
@interface RCTEventDispatcher() <RCTBridgeModule, RCTFrameUpdateObserver>
@end
@implementation RCTEventDispatcher
{
NSMutableDictionary *_eventQueue;
NSLock *_eventQueueLock;
}
@synthesize bridge = _bridge;
@synthesize paused = _paused;
RCT_EXPORT_MODULE()
- (instancetype)init
{
if ((self = [super init])) {
_eventQueue = [[NSMutableDictionary alloc] init];
_eventQueueLock = [[NSLock alloc] init];
}
return self;
}
- (void)sendAppEventWithName:(NSString *)name body:(id)body
{
[_bridge enqueueJSCall:@"RCTNativeAppEventEmitter.emit"
args:body ? @[name, body] : @[name]];
}
- (void)sendDeviceEventWithName:(NSString *)name body:(id)body
{
[_bridge enqueueJSCall:@"RCTDeviceEventEmitter.emit"
args:body ? @[name, body] : @[name]];
}
- (void)sendInputEventWithName:(NSString *)name body:(NSDictionary *)body
{
if (RCT_DEBUG) {
RCTAssert([body[@"target"] isKindOfClass:[NSNumber class]],
@"Event body dictionary must include a 'target' property containing a React tag");
}
name = RCTNormalizeInputEventName(name);
[_bridge enqueueJSCall:@"RCTEventEmitter.receiveEvent"
args:body ? @[body[@"target"], name, body] : @[body[@"target"], name]];
}
- (void)sendTextEventWithType:(RCTTextEventType)type
reactTag:(NSNumber *)reactTag
text:(NSString *)text
eventCount:(NSInteger)eventCount
{
static NSString *events[] = {
@"focus",
@"blur",
@"change",
@"submitEditing",
@"endEditing",
};
[self sendInputEventWithName:events[type] body:text ? @{
@"text": text,
@"eventCount": @(eventCount),
@"target": reactTag
} : @{
@"eventCount": @(eventCount),
@"target": reactTag
}];
}
- (void)sendEvent:(id<RCTEvent>)event
{
if (!event.canCoalesce) {
[self dispatchEvent:event];
return;
}
[_eventQueueLock lock];
NSNumber *eventID = RCTGetEventID(event);
id<RCTEvent> previousEvent = _eventQueue[eventID];
if (previousEvent) {
event = [previousEvent coalesceWithEvent:event];
}
_eventQueue[eventID] = event;
_paused = NO;
[_eventQueueLock unlock];
}
- (void)dispatchEvent:(id<RCTEvent>)event
{
NSMutableArray *arguments = [[NSMutableArray alloc] init];
if (event.viewTag) {
[arguments addObject:event.viewTag];
}
[arguments addObject:RCTNormalizeInputEventName(event.eventName)];
if (event.body) {
[arguments addObject:event.body];
}
[_bridge enqueueJSCall:[[event class] moduleDotMethod]
args:arguments];
}
- (dispatch_queue_t)methodQueue
{
return RCTJSThread;
}
- (void)didUpdateFrame:(__unused RCTFrameUpdate *)update
{
[_eventQueueLock lock];
NSDictionary *eventQueue = _eventQueue;
_eventQueue = [[NSMutableDictionary alloc] init];
_paused = YES;
[_eventQueueLock unlock];
for (id<RCTEvent> event in eventQueue.allValues) {
[self dispatchEvent:event];
}
}
@end
